Delayed fall freezes increasing crop maturity window

SHARE NOW

An ag meteorologist says the next two weeks look mostly favorable for dry down in the Eastern Corn Belt.

Michigan state climatologist Jeff Andresen says the drier weather will be beneficial for later maturing corn.

“In terms of maturation and dry down, it’s probably a near-optimal situation for most people getting these crops to move along if they haven’t matured,” he says.

He says the first freezes of fall will likely be delayed at least another week or two for much of the Midwest.
